Grant create table permission on schema

WebDec 29, 2024 · A combination of ALTER and REFERENCE permissions in some cases could allow the grantee to view data or execute unauthorized functions. For example: A …

SQL Server - Give user permission to create table in their …

WebMar 28, 2024 · >Permissions for creating schemas; Requires CREATE SCHEMA permission on the database. To create an object specified within the CREATE SCHEMA statement, the user must have the corresponding CREATE permission. To specify another user as the owner of the schema being created, the caller must have IMPERSONATE … WebMay 21, 2012 · To create procedures, you must have CREATE PROCEDURE permission in the database and ALTER permission on the schema in which the procedure is being … eastberg gypsum https://handsontherapist.com

GRANT CREATE TABLE/PROCEDURE to ROLE on Specific Schema

WebCREATE: Create a schema ( not a table) TEMP: Create temporary objects, including but not limited to temp tables. Now, each PostgreSQL database by default has a public schema … WebMar 24, 2024 · The users in the AD group have the Create table permission in schema1 only. create table schema1.test_only with ( distribution = ROUND_ROBIN) as select * from dbo.test_only Error: Msg 6004, Level 14, State 9, Line 7 User does not have permission to perform this action. Changed database context to 'databasename'. The permission is: WebThe minimum permission required is ALTER on table_name. TRUNCATE TABLE permissions default to the table owner, members of the sysadmin fixed server role, and the db_owner and db_ddladmin fixed database roles, and are not transferable. east berenicemouth

GRANT - Amazon Redshift

Category:SQL Server - granting permissions to an entire schema vs. object?

Tags:Grant create table permission on schema

Grant create table permission on schema

permissions - SQL Server database level roles for creating tables ...

WebJul 25, 2024 · CREATE ROLE ModifyTable; GO GRANT CREATE TABLE TO ModifyTable; GRANT ALTER ON SCHEMA::dbo TO ModifyTable; GO EXEC sp_addrolemember 'ModifyTable', 'Test'; GO Now, because a user has ALTER permissions on the schema, he/she can affect existing objects. So you'll have to build a DDL trigger to restrict the role … WebApr 10, 2024 · But I though whether could exist a more straightforward way for granting only on the tables like this: my_schema: +schema: my_schema +grants: select: [ 'REPORTER' ] type: table intermediate: materialized: view # ROLE2'd not be revoked in views in this case. permissions. snowflake-cloud-data-platform. dbt. Share.

Grant create table permission on schema

Did you know?

WebDec 30, 2024 · CREATE SCHEMA can create a schema, the tables and views it contains, and GRANT, REVOKE, or DENY permissions on any securable in a single statement. This statement must be executed as a separate batch. Objects created by the CREATE SCHEMA statement are created inside the schema that is being created. CREATE … WebMay 21, 2012 · GRANT CREATE TABLE ON SCHEMA :: [TEST] TO NEW_ROLE WITH GRANT OPTION GO. Incorrect syntax near 'CREATE TABLE..'. The CREATE TABLE is granted at the DB level and you grant the ALTER at the schema level. The combination of the 2 permissions will allow a user to actually create a table in the schema.

WebJul 30, 2024 · Officially a schema is a collection of tables. Whereas a user is an account you use to connect to the database. Some databases allow you to make a distinction … WebIn the past if you have a schema with many tables under it and you want to grant the application account SELECT permission on these tables…you have 2 options: Option …

WebJan 6, 2016 · You can GRANT schema permissions that are effective for everything existing and everything that will exist in that schema. Grant Schema Permissions GRANT SELECT, INSERT, UPDATE, DELETE ON SCHEMA :: TO ; Further to that, if you want to then deny permissions on a certain object within that schema, you … WebGRANT SELECT ON FUTURE TABLES IN DATABASE d1 TO ROLE r1; Grant the INSERT and DELETE privileges on all future tables in the d1.s1 schema to role r2. GRANT INSERT,DELETE ON FUTURE TABLES IN SCHEMA d1.s1 TO ROLE r2; The future grants assigned to the r1 role are ignored completely.

WebON ALL TABLES IN SCHEMA schema_name Grants the specified privileges on all tables and views in the referenced schema. ( column_name [,...] ) ON TABLE table_name Grants the specified privileges to users, groups, or PUBLIC on the specified columns of the Amazon Redshift table or view. ( column_list ) ON EXTERNAL TABLE schema_name.table_name

WebGranting permission to create tables to a specific user in a specific database not only requires CREATE TABLE permissions but also requires ALTER permissions to the schema, e.g. DBO. USE [databasename] GRANT ALTER ON Schema :: [schemaname] TO [username] GRANT CREATE TABLE TO [username] GO For example; east berbice guyanaWebGrants the privilege to create objects in the schema. to create the object (such as CREATETAB) are still required. The owner of an explicitly created schema automatically receives CREATEIN privilege. An implicitly created schema has CREATEIN privilege automatically granted to PUBLIC. DATAACCESS Grants the authority to access data in … east bentleigh senior citizensWebGRANT USAGE ON SCHEMA schema TO role; From the documentation: USAGE: For schemas, allows access to objects contained in the specified schema (assuming that the objects' own privilege requirements are also met). Essentially this allows the grantee to "look up" objects within the schema. cuban independence spanish american warWebMar 22, 2024 · GRANT SELECT ON ALL TABLES IN SCHEMA public TO student; ALTER DEFAULT PRIVILEGES IN SCHEMA public FOR ROLE teacher GRANT SELECT ON TABLES TO student; The last command assumes the tables will be created by the user/role teacher. Share Improve this answer Follow edited Mar 25, 2024 at 21:55 answered Mar … cuban imports and exportsWebApr 12, 2024 · Schema privileges go against the "least privileges" principle by granting access to all objects of a specific type. For many use cases we should avoid schema privileges, which makes our lives harder, but potentially safer. There are many system and admin privileges that are excluded from schema privileges, listed here. cuban import of handmade craftsWebFeb 3, 2016 · GRANT CREATE TABLE TO UserName GRANT ALTER ON SCHEMA::AllowedSchema TO UserName DENY ALTER ON SCHEMA::RestrictedSchema TO UserName Viewing 3 posts - 1 through 2 (of 2 total) Login to... cuban imports cigarsWebDec 29, 2024 · The following example grants CONTROL permission on the AdventureWorks2012 database to the database user Sarah. The user must exist in the database and the context must be set to the database. SQL. USE AdventureWorks2012; GRANT CONTROL ON DATABASE::AdventureWorks2012 TO Sarah; GO. cuban information archives